[Bug 391628] Re: Everything gets swapped out after resume from suspend using fglrx drivers
I get this too, exactly as described in the initial bug report, with Ubuntu 11.04 on a HP Pavillion DV6-1210SA with an ATI card and the fglrx drivers. Is there any movement on getting it fixed please? It is definitely my number 1 gripe with Ubuntu. It definitely seems to be related to suspending whilst there is some swap usage. Upon resume kswapd just goes mad and keeps moving things to swap until it is 100% full. The only way I can stop it is by either 'sudo swapoff -a' or reboot. Has anyone come up with a workaround if a fix isn't available yet (it has been 2 years since the initial report, it seems it is being avoided!)? [Bug 755847] [NEW] Headphone jack sense not working on HP Pavilion DV6-1210SA
Public bug reported: Binary package hint: pulseaudio Hi Apologies, I don't think this is a pulseaudio bug, but I'm not sure of a better place to put sound issues. Please reassign it if you have more knowledge than I do on the subject! When I plug headphones in to the jack on my HP Pavilion DV6-1210SA laptop, I get sound coming out of both the speakers and the headphones. I've googled for 'Ubuntu jack sense' and it seems that people have been having this problem for years with different laptops. The only way I can get sound coming out of just the headphones is if I go to the sound settings and change the Output Connector to 'Analogue Output' as opposed to the default 'Analogue Speakers'. This is very inconvenient and I have to change it back to 'Analogue Speakers when I want to use the speakers again. [Bug 721896] Re: kswapd0 100% cpu usage
I get this bug too on my HP Pavilion DV6 laptop. For me it only ever happens after a suspend to ram, and the symptoms are the same. My physical ram is 50% full, but the swap space just fills up and churns the hard disc forever. The system becomes barely usable (mouse pointer even sticks for long lengths of time) even though the CPU is 25% in use. sudo swapoff -a seems to solve the problem after a few minutes. [Bug 467592] [NEW] curlftpfs io error with simple use case
Public bug reported: Binary package hint: curlftpfs Under a simple use case, curlftpfs doesn't work. Enter the following at a terminal: mkdir test sudo curlftpfs -o allow_other upload.ntlworld.com test echo Hello test/test.txt (note the curlftpfs command needs your logon details to be stored in ~/.netrc prior to issuing this command) The output from the echo command is: bash: echo: write error: Input/output error Another use case that exhibits the same behaviour is: mkdir .git sudo curlftpfs -o allow_other upload.ntlworld.com .git git init Output of the git command is: error: /home/graham/.git/description: close error: Input/output error fatal: cannot copy /usr/share/git-core/templates/description to /home/graham/.git/description I'm guessing that both the echo and git use case are caused by the same bug as they exhibit very similar behaviours. I read somewhere on the internet that this is caused by the ftp file being flushed before the release command, or something like that, but I can't find the article any more sorry!
